Synchronizing with the Server

Upon initiating synchronization, the AirBEAM Smart Client attempts to open an FTP session using the AirBEAM Smart Client
configuration. Once connected, the client processes the specified packages. Packages are loaded only if the server version of a given
package is different from the version loaded on the client. When upload is completes, the AirBEAM Smart Client closes the FTP
session with the server.
The AirBEAM Smart Client can launch an FTP session with the server either when initiated by the user or automatically.
Manual Synchronization
1. Configure the AirBEAM Smart Client. See
2. From the main AirBEAM CE window, tap File - Synchronize.
3. Once connected, the AirBEAM Synchronize dialog appears.
• The Status List displays status messages that indicate the progress of the synchronization
process.
• Tap ok to return to the Main Menu. This button remains inactive until the synchronization
process completes.
• Tap Retry to restart the synchronization process. This button is active only if there is an error
during synchronization.

AirBEAM Staging

The AirBEAM Smart staging support speeds up and simplifies the process of staging custom or updated operating software onto
mobile devices directly from manufacturing. The staging support is part of the AirBEAM Smart CE Client integrated in the mobile
computer.
The AirBEAM Smart support defaults the AirBEAM Client configuration to a known set of values and launches the AirBEAM Smart
package download logic. A staging environment, including an RF network, FTP server, and AirBEAM packages must be set up. Ideally,
set up a staging network and server to match the default AirBEAM Staging client configuration.
The AirBEAM Smart staging utility is invoked from the Applications directory (tap Start - Programs - File Explorer - Application).
The AirBEAM Staging support provides several benefits:
• Loading many devices simultaneously over the RF network.
• Provides a simple single dialog user interface used to quickly start the software installation process.
